Zhangjiajie National Forest Park is the main attraction of Zhangjiajie. It is famous for its sandstone landforms, precarious peaks, limpid streams, dense forests, and large karst caves. More than 3,000 mountain peaks of various shapes are congregated here in the park, forming a spectacular scenery. The park was thrust into foreign travelers' eyes after the booming success of the movie “Avatar”, in which the Hallelujah Mountains were inspired by the Heavenly piller of Zhangjiajie National Forest Park. The main attractions in the park are Yuanjiajie, Tianzi Peak, Golden Whip Stream and Yellow Stone Village. The mountains have peculiar shapes, often surrounded by fog and mist giving visitors a view similar to the drawings of a traditional chinese painting.
Present your ID cardorPassportorMainland Travel Permit for Hong Kong and Macau Residents for direct verification and access.
Please scan the original Mainland Chinese ID and face to enter the park at the first entry. Only facial information is needed for your second entry. Please go to the window in time (windows 2 and 3 at the east gate, window 4 at the south gate) if you used passport and other documents for booking or your ID fails.
